Tropical storms frequently impact Rhode Island with extreme wind and flooding. A pre-loss room-by-room record helps adjusters settle contents claims faster when severe weather strikes.
Preparation checklist for Rhode Island
- ✓ Photograph roof, windows, and garage doors before June 1 each year.
- ✓ Document contents in every room including closets, garages, and outbuildings.
- ✓ Store receipts and serial numbers for high-value electronics, appliances, and furniture.
- ✓ Share a read-only voluntary disclosure link with your insurance agent or attorney before storm season.
- ✓ Download a full vault backup off-site annually — see the Vault Backup guide.
- ✓ Tag portable items and note where critical papers live for evacuation planning.
